#7342: make sure that the datetime object in test_fraction always has a number of...
[python.git] / Demo / parser / source.py
blobb90062851fe60b2bcc41b51e26f86c18eb6ea1a2
1 """Exmaple file to be parsed for the parsermodule example.
3 The classes and functions in this module exist only to exhibit the ability
4 of the handling information extraction from nested definitions using parse
5 trees. They shouldn't interest you otherwise!
6 """
8 class Simple:
9 "This class does very little."
11 def method(self):
12 "This method does almost nothing."
13 return 1
15 class Nested:
16 "This is a nested class."
18 def nested_method(self):
19 "Method of Nested class."
20 def nested_function():
21 "Function in method of Nested class."
22 pass
23 return nested_function
25 def function():
26 "This function lives at the module level."
27 return 0